I used this product once, and I can say the blades are too sharp. I know, that sounds like a non-problem. Of course they're sharp, it's a grater! But it's like the little teeth are too far away from the plane. When I tried to zest a lemon, the lemon got caught on the teeth and my hand kept moving. As I continued to zest the lemon, it got caught on the teeth multiple times, and flew out of my hand almost as many.
The blade cover also has holes/slits in it for some reason. This just seems like a great way to cut my hand when I reach into the drawer. I'll be donating this item. I've already ordered the name brand replacement.
